Description
The αR1 monoclonal antibody specifically binds to the human platelet derived growth factor (PDGF) receptor α (PDGFRα), also known as CD140a. CD140a is a 170 kDa single transmembrane glycoprotein expressed on fibroblasts, smooth muscle cells, glial cells and chondrocytes. PDGF receptors α and β are single glycoproteins with intracellular tyrosine kinase domains. They are structurally similar to the M-CSF receptor and CD117 (c-kit). Their ligand, PDGF, is a mitogen for connective tissue cells and glial cells. PDGF plays a role in wound healing and it also acts as a chemoattractant for fibroblasts, smooth muscle cells, glial cells, monocytes and neutrophils. Functional PDGF is secreted in disulfide linked, homodimeric or heterodimeric forms comprised of A or B chains (PDGFAA, PDGF-BB or PDGF-AB). Binding of divalent PDGF induces receptor dimerization with three possible forms: αα, αβ, ββ. The PDGFRα subunit binds both PDGF A and B chains, whereas the PDGFRβ subunit binds only PDGF B chains. Although both receptor subunits can stimulate mitogenic responses, only the β subunit can induce chemotaxis. The αR1 antibody is specific for PDGFRα and does not crossreact with PDGFR β . It immunoprecipitates human, monkey, rabbit, pig, dog and cat PDGFR α . It does not recognize hamster, rat or mouse PDGFR α .
This antibody is routinely tested by flow cytometric analysis. Other applications were tested at BD Biosciences Pharmingen during antibody development only or reported in the literature.
